The Flow Dress makes a beautiful evening dress - particularly sewn in a flowing silk (silk chiffon or silk satin) or a viscose crepe.

 PATTERN FEATURES:

  • STYLE A - Front neck closure (hook & eye, button & loop, long tie or without)
  • STYLE B - Back neck closure (we love this with a large tie for special occassions!)
  • Dress & top (maxi length dress, top or easily adjust the length for anything in between)
  • Internal side pockets
  • Sizes NZ/AU 6-24 | US 2-20 (purchased in size bundles of 4)-refer purchasing options

FABRIC

Light weight WOVEN fabrics with fluid DRAPE (the fabric falls nicely downward against the body as opposed to voluminous drape which billows out).
We highly recommend rayon, viscose, satin, chiffons & tencel. Silk chiffon, georgette or crepe works beautifully for occasion dressing.

Stay away from stiff tightly woven fabrics that do not drape (like denim, silk taffeta & suitings)

Refer product images for examples of fabric we've used.
Refer last product image for detailed fabric & haberdashery requirements.

DIFFICULTY

INTERMEDIATE

Learn how to sew a concave and convex curve (neck facing) and an innovative technique sewing the armholes.

The neck facing is finished with a curved "stitch-in-the-ditch" which is a llittle fiddly, however, hand sewing this will produce a professional finish and simplify the process.

SIZE & FITTING

The Flow dress & top have excessive ease as part of the core design. If you measure between the sizes on our size chart we recommend you size down.

The most relevant sizing consideration is the underarm. If you are large in the bust but slim in the arms we recommend you grade to a smaller size under the arm.

Our models measure as follows:
Lynley (red & green maxi lengths & top)- size UK/NZ10 (US6) - 179cm tall - A cup
Rachel (blue & white floral maxi)- size UK/NZ14 (US10) - 174cm tall - E cup
Inez (grey circle print maxi) - size UK/NZ22 (US18) - 174cm tall - E cup
